Well, yes and no. He started off by novelizing the radio show, which came out to about three books with some things added, and then finished them up... but then he kept writing. Publishers/etc. were already promoting H2G2, RatEotU, and LtUaE as a trilogy by the time that SLaTfAtF came out, so he said OK FINE and said it was now a four-book trilogy. Then he wrote MH, which made it a five book trilogy.
